President Joe Biden will restore Bears Ears and Grand Staircase-Escalante national monuments in Utah to the size they were before former President Donald Trump cut hundreds of thousands of acres from them, and will also restore the Northeast Canyons and Seamounts Marine National Monument situated off the New England coast, the White House announced.
A Florida federal judge on Wednesday granted YouTube's request to transfer former President Donald Trump's censorship lawsuit against the tech company to the Northern District of California, finding that a forum-selection clause within YouTube's terms of service is enforceable.
U.S. District Judge Alan Albright has sent Fintiv Inc.'s infringement suit against Apple over its mobile wallet back to Austin and scheduled the trial to begin in the new year, just days after the Federal Circuit said the judge abused his discretion when he retransferred the suit to Waco.
Dr. Seuss Enterprises and ComicMix LLC said that they have settled the long-running copyright lawsuit filed by the famed author's estate over the Dr. Seuss-"Star Trek" mashup "Oh the Places You'll Boldly Go," according to a joint motion filed in California federal court Tuesday.
A Florida federal jury on Monday awarded a Sunshine State car dealership $16 million in its contract suit against Hyundai Motor America after determining the automaker violated its agreement with the dealership when it tried to showcase its luxury Genesis brand by creating a separate dealer network.
